O Ubuntu Software Center não inicia / desinstala [12.10]

2

Isso surgiu em algum lugar durante o processo de instalação de um driver nvidia (310.32) para minha placa gráfica. Sempre que eu clicava no ícone do Ubuntu Software Center no lançador, parecia funcionar (animação no ícone para mostrar que estava começando), e depois nada. Então eu fiz a primeira coisa estúpida, tentei remover e reinstalar o Centro de Software; aparentemente, a remoção não funcionou corretamente, então tentei novamente. Aqui está a sessão do terminal:

parth@Gladoss:~$ sudo apt-get remove software-center
Reading package lists... Done
Building dependency tree       
Reading state information... Done
The following packages will be REMOVED:
  software-center
0 upgraded, 0 newly installed, 1 to remove and 304 not upgraded.
1 not fully installed or removed.
After this operation, 4,485 kB disk space will be freed.
Do you want to continue [Y/n]? Y
(Reading database ... 176079 files and directories currently installed.)
Removing software-center ...
dpkg: error processing software-center (--remove):
 unable to securely remove '/usr/share/app-install/menu.d/featured.menu': Not a directory
No apport report written because MaxReports is reached already
Errors were encountered while processing:
 software-center
E: Sub-process /usr/bin/dpkg returned an error code (1)
parth@Gladoss:~$ 

Deixe-me saber como posso remover e reinstalar corretamente o programa. Obrigado.

EDITAR: comando sudo apt-get update pára com mensagem de erro (terminal)

W: Erro GPG: ppa.launchpad.net quantal Release: As seguintes assinaturas não puderam ser verificadas porque a chave pública não está disponível: NO_PUBKEY 4F191A5A8844C542

EDITAR: Tentei os comandos: (i) sudo rm /usr/share/app-install/menu.d/featured.menu resultado: diretório não existe. (ii) sudo rm -rf /usr/share/app-install/menu.d/featured.menu resultado: nada. Terminal fica pronto para aceitar nova linha. Além disso, eu tentei "sudo apt-get install software-center". Mesma mensagem de erro da postagem original.

EDITAR: sudo apt-get --reinstall instala retornos do centro de software

(Lendo banco de dados ... 176080 arquivos e diretórios atualmente instalados.) Preparando para substituir o centro de software 5.4.1.2 (usando ... / software-center_5.4.1.4_all.deb) ... Descompactando o centro de software de substituição ... dpkg: erro processando /var/cache/apt/archives/software-center_5.4.1.4_all.deb (--unpack):  tentando sobrescrever '/ usr / share / app-install / desktop', que também está no pacote app-install-data-partner 12.12.10 Processando triggers para utilitários de arquivos de desktop ... Processando triggers para bamfdaemon ... Reconstruindo /usr/share/applications/bamf.index ... Processando gatilhos para menus do gnome ... Processando triggers para hicolor-icon-theme ... Erros foram encontrados durante o processamento: /var/cache/apt/archives/software-center_5.4.1.4_all.deb E: Subprocesso / usr / bin / dpkg retornou um código de erro (1)

EDITAR: Eu percebi que algo estava errado com o dpkg, eu pesquisei isso. Alguns comandos que experimentei depois.

parth @ Gladoss: ~ $ sudo dpkg --audit Os seguintes pacotes são apenas parcialmente instalados, devido a problemas durante instalação. A instalação provavelmente pode ser concluída, repetindo-a; os pacotes podem ser removidos usando dselect ou dpkg --remove:  software-center Utilitário para navegar, instalar e remover software

parth @ Gladoss: ~ $ sudo dpkg --remove o software-center (Lendo banco de dados ... 176079 arquivos e diretórios atualmente instalados.) Removendo o software-center ... dpkg: error processing software-center (--remove):  Incapaz de remover com segurança '/usr/share/app-install/menu.d/featured.menu': Não é um diretório Erros foram encontrados durante o processamento:  centro de software

[Em sucessão]

EDITAR: sudo dpkg -L software-center traz um monte de arquivos; incluindo /usr/share/app-install/menu.d/featured.menu Se está sendo mostrado aqui, como é que uma força recursiva remove ignora? Seus outros comandos (não relacionados a rm) podem funcionar?

    
por user132875 17.02.2013 / 14:20

2 respostas

0

Remover manualmente

  

/usr/share/app-install/menu.d/featured.menu

sudo rm /usr/share/app-install/menu.d/featured.menu

Em seguida, tente reinstalar o Software Center

sudo apt-get --reinstall install software-center
    
por LnxSlck 17.02.2013 / 14:27
0

Extraído de outro tópico - ( Posso desinstalar e reinstalar o Ubuntu Software? Centro? )

Você fez o primeiro passo da resposta principal, agora tente as três outras etapas:

  1. sudo apt-get autoremove software-center
  2. sudo apt-get update
  3. sudo apt-get install software-center

A alternativa está na resposta de Eliah Kagans

  1. sudo apt-get update
  2. sudo apt-get --purge --reinstall install software-center

Espero que o tópico anterior possa ajudar mais com isso.

    
por Timlah 17.02.2013 / 14:36